Playa Grande reopens to the bathroom in Puerto de la Cruz

The Municipality of Puerto de la Cruz reopens this Friday to the bathroom Big beach of Playa Jardinonce the General Directorate of Public Health of the Government of the Canary Islands has determined that the quality of the water is suitable.

This past Wednesday, the closure of this bathing area after the analysis of one of the ordinary water samples that are collected periodically on the beach showed alterations in the biological parameters. However, the analysis of a new sample collected yesterday by Public Health reveals that the water no longer has these alterations and, consequently, its quality is suitable for bathing.

The City Council recalls that periodic analyzes of the water are carried out on all the beaches in the municipality to guarantee that its quality conforms to the parameters established by the General Directorate of Public Health.
